Adam C Cook is a breeder of Hereford cattle in Greenbrier, AR, operating in Faulkner County and central Arkansas near Little Rock.
With several years of hands-on experience, they maintain membership in national Hereford associations and follow recommended health testing for fertility and disease. Cattle graze rotationally managed pastures and calves spend their first weeks in a dedicated nursery paddock to ensure steady growth and calm temperament. They emphasize low-stress handling and socialization, with quiet routines and regular herd health checks by a local veterinarian.
The farm’s focus on balanced genetics and adaptability supports robust animals suited for both small-scale herding and commercial operations. A customer noted that Cook’s cattle tended to settle quickly into new environments, a testament to consistent care and breeding philosophy. All stock is raised on a mix of native grasses and supplemented with a locally sourced grain blend to promote steady weight gain through changing seasons.
